How bad is this soda for you?



I usually try to stay away from soda, but the other day I picked some up from the grocery store (I was craving it). I was wondering how bad this type is for you…

It is Hansen’s Diet soda. It has No: carbs, calories, preservatives, sodium, caffeine, fat, sugar, or aspartame.

The two types I have:

Kiwi Strawberry
Contains:
Pure triple filtered carbonated water, citric acid, natural potassium citrate, natural fruit flavors with extracts of Chilean kiwi fruit & pacific northwest strawberries, acesulfame potassium, sucralose (Splenda® brand).

Root Beer
Contains:
Pure triple filtered carbonated water, caramel color, potassium citrate, phosphoric acid, sucralose (Splenda® brand), acesulfame potassium, natural flavors (licorice root extracts, Madagascan vanilla, wintergreen anse), acacia.

How bad are these for you? Which one is better?
